Preparing Your Pet for Travel
Proper preparation is key to ensuring a smooth journey. Before traveling, it is important to ensure that your pet is healthy and ready for transport.
A visit to the veterinarian is recommended to confirm that your pet is fit for travel. Vaccinations should be up to date, and any necessary documentation should be prepared in advance.
Familiar items such as blankets, toys, or bedding can help reduce anxiety during travel. These items provide a sense of comfort and familiarity for your pet.
Feeding schedules should also be adjusted to avoid discomfort during the journey. Light meals and proper hydration are essential.
Onboarding Tips for Newcomers
Arriving in Sacramento with your pet involves more than just transportation. Onboarding your pet into a new environment requires careful attention.
Once you arrive, allow your pet time to adjust to their new surroundings. Gradual introductions to the home and neighborhood can help reduce stress.
Establishing a routine is important for helping your pet feel secure. Regular feeding, walking, and playtime schedules provide consistency.
Exploring local pet services, such as veterinarians, grooming centers, and pet stores, can also help you settle in more quickly.
Safety and Comfort During Transport
Ensuring your pet’s safety and comfort during transport is a top priority. Proper restraints, ventilation, and temperature control are essential components of a safe journey.
Pets should always be secured in appropriate carriers or harnesses to prevent injury. Adequate ventilation ensures that they remain comfortable throughout the trip.
Monitoring your pet’s behavior during travel can help identify any signs of stress or discomfort. Addressing these issues promptly ensures a smoother experience.
